			<description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;FEAT GAVIN MARTIN ( Open / Bus / Green Ant )&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Sunday 20th September 2009&lt;br /&gt;Society Restaurant &amp;amp; Bar&lt;br /&gt;Level 1, 15 Spence Street, Cairns&lt;br /&gt;3pm till 12am&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Tickets $10 - Available on the door or from We're.&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Gavin Martin is one of the most recognised and celebrated DJs to emerge from the Melbourne underground dance community. Whether its ripping apart daytime dance floors at Australias biggest festivals, touring internationally or captivating a sweaty club until dawn, whenever you catch a Gavin Martin set, you know youre in for a treat.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Ever diverse, his style blends elements of the evolving sounds of deep progressive, techno and house, with intelligent atmospherics and an ear for forward-thinking sonics. QLD.&lt;br /&gt;6PM UNTIL LATE&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;PHOTOCOPULIST will be a poster show featuring new and previous work by We Buy Your Kids. On show and for sale will be a selection of some of their favorite poster and illustration work, blown up in black and white and presented as giant photocopied bill posters out of their original context. It will also feature a selection of silk screen and giclee prints of their work from the last twelve months.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;There is an element of speed and urgency with all WBYK&amp;rsquo;s work, but particularly their poster designs.
